ABOUT THE SPEAKER: Lawrence B. Finer, Ph.D., is Director of Domestic Research at the Guttmacher Institute. He supervises the Institute’s research portfolio of U.S.-focused projects on pregnancy and abortion, contraceptive use, family planning services, and adolescent reproductive health. His primary research focus is unintended pregnancy at the national and state level, and he has published work on premarital sex, the reasons women seek abortions, and the services provided by U.S. family planning clinics. He also serves as a Senior Lecturer in Population and Family Health at the Columbia School of Public Health.
